L-Threonine, methyl ester, hydrochloride (1:1) Use and Manufacturing
L-Threonine was dissolved in methanalic HCl solution (2M)and refluxed the reaction mixture for 1 h. Then the organicsolvent was evaporated using rotary evaporator and againsame methanalic HCl solution was added to the reactionmixture and refluxed for 1 h. After the reaction time, theorganic solvent was evaporated under reduced pressure togive white solid compound. ESI–MS: m/z at 134.2 [M+ +H].A 250 ml 3-necked round-bottom flask was equipped with a condenser, a dropping funnel and a rubber septum. The condenser was fitted with a calcium chloride drying tube. The dropping funnel was charged with acetyl chloride (23.0 ml, 0.33 mol). The flask was filled with 75 mls of methanol and cooled to 0 °C in an ice bath under nitrogen. The acetyl chloride is added dropwise over 5 min before L-threonine (13.58 g, 0.11 mol) was added before heating to reflux temperature. After 2 h the solvent is removed in vacuo to yield a white fluffy solid (18.75 g, 97percent), which was used without further purification. A mixture of 10 (5.4 g, 24.6 mmol) and 6 N HCl (60 mL) was refluxed for 5 h, and after cooling to ambient temperature, the reaction mixture was extracted with diethyl ether (3×70 mL) to remove benzoic acid. The aqueous layer was evaporated to dryness under reduced pressure, and the residue was further dried under high vacuum overnight to afford crude allo-L-threonine. MeOH (25 mL) was cooled to 0 C, and thionyl chloride (1.80 mL, 25.2 mmol) was added dropwise. To the resulting HCl methanol solution was added the crude allo-L-threonine, and the reaction mixture was heated under reflux for 1 h. The solvent was removed in vacuo, and another batch of HCl methanol solution (prepared in the same manner) was added, and then the reaction mixture was heated under reflux for another 1 h.
